SEI(Stackpole Elec) MLFM15FTC120R is a MLFM15FTC120R from SEI(Stackpole Elec), part of the Chip Resistor - Surface Mount. It is designed for 200mW Thin Film Resistor ±50ppm/℃ ±1% 120Ω 0102 Chip Resistor - Surface Mount ROHS. This product comes in a 0102 package and is sold as Tape & Reel (TR). Key features include:
- Power(Watts): 200mW
- Type: Thin Film Resistor
- Temperature Coefficient: ±50ppm/℃
- Tolerance: ±1%
- Operating Temperature Range: -55℃~+155℃
- Resistance: 120Ω
Additional details: This product is environmentally friendly, does not contain a battery, and weighs approximately 1 grams.
